Course Content

• Introduction to Sovereign Debt: Macroeconomic Fundamentals and Debt Sustainability
• Sovereign Debt Crises: Case Studies and Comparative Analysis (including keywords: debt default, debt restructuring)
• The Role of International Financial Institutions (IMF, World Bank) in Debt Resolution
• Legal Aspects of Sovereign Debt: Contracts, Bankruptcy, and Restructuring
• Debt Management Strategies and Prevention of Crises
• The Political Economy of Sovereign Debt Crises
• Analyzing Sovereign Credit Ratings and Risk Assessment
• Impact of Sovereign Debt Crises on Economic Growth and Development

Why this course?

Certificate Programmes in Sovereign Debt Crises hold immense significance in today's volatile global market. Understanding sovereign debt management is crucial, given the increasing frequency and severity of these crises. The UK, while not currently experiencing a crisis, is not immune to global economic shocks. For instance, the UK's national debt has risen substantially in recent years.

Year Debt (£bn)
2019 1875
2020 2105
2021 2340
2022 2500

Understanding the complexities of sovereign debt markets, including risk assessment and mitigation strategies, is therefore a highly sought-after skill.
